What costs are treated as product costs under the absorption costing method?
Absorption Costing
An accounting method that includes all direct costs and overhead costs related to the production of a specific product.
Product Costs
Expenses directly attributable to the creation of a product, including material, labor, and overhead costs.

Final Answer :
Under absorption costing,direct labor,direct materials,and all manufacturing overhead costs,both fixed and variable,are treated as product costs.
